What To Expect

Camp Dates & Location
July 17th – 21st 2023 Providence students will head to Camp Bob Cooper in Summerton, SC. Learn more details about Bob Cooper here.
 
Medical
All medication (both prescription and OTC) is to be given to the Student Ministry Medical Team at check-in on Monday. The medical team will distribute ALL medicine during the week of camp. Students are responsible to see the medical team when it is time to take their medicine.
 
Meals
Meals are included in the registration cost. Meals are provided by the camp cafeteria served by Bob Cooper Camp Staff following all health guidelines. Please notify us of dietary restrictions ahead of time so that the Bob Cooper Camp Staff can prepare accordingly.
 
Transportation
We will take fifty-six passenger buses to Camp Bob Cooper in Summerton, South Carolina. Each bus will be pre-cleaned and have a bathroom on board. Travel departure and arrival times will be communicated closer to camp.
 
Lodging
Students will be grouped by gender and grade in bunk-style cabins. Some grades may be combined to maximize sleeping arrangements. Each cabin has separate showers and restrooms. Any questions or concerns may be directed to the Student Ministry Team.

Counselors/Volunteers
Each counselor and volunteer is interviewed and vetted for serving at summer camp by Jarrick, Kevin, and the student ministry team. Each counselor will be trained, equipped, and excited to serve your student throughout the week. We will plan for the counselors to have an in-person or virtual meeting with students prior to camp.
 
Electronics
No electronic devices will be allowed at camp, this includes: cell phones, ipads/ipods, hand-held video games, Laptops, etc. If these items are found at camp, they will be confiscated and returned upon arrival at Providence on Friday, July 21. Campers are not allowed to make phone calls other than to their parents, and will need to see the Camp Director, Kevin Lambeth, to do so.
